Output e6835a561f30765b800d74f3ab159ddd02a330f503b9c381924e39bc0c28bd59:3

value
19124703
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6952af1436ca6e8955a94c21e0b06971f57c1665 OP_EQUALVERIFY OP_CHECKSIG
address
1Abu17z9EHJCXhUhdrDbbBm6vyztgY9rab
transaction
e6835a561f30765b800d74f3ab159ddd02a330f503b9c381924e39bc0c28bd59
spent
true